And it dates back decades, even to "advice" columns in magazines
recommending to turn VERIFY off in DOS.
(NOTE: for those unfamiliar: "VERIFY" (both DOS and Int13h) was not a read
after write compare of content; it merely confirmed that each sector that
was written was readable.)
